General Assistant Job at University of Maryland Baltimore County

University of Maryland Baltimore County Baltimore, MD 21250

Department:

Registrar's Office



Responsibilities:

The incumbent will provide front-line support for the customer service operations of the Registrar's Office.

The General Assistant will:

  • Provide customer service by greeting visitors and answering phones
  • Processing declaration of majors forms
  • Assist with Undergraduate Graduation process
  • Assist with Transfer rule verification project

Duties include monitoring, responding to and routing a high volume of email. The position coordinates and executes responses to a high volume of inquiries regarding student records, registration, transfer credit, and graduation.

After training, telework may be available.

Schedule will tentatively be Monday-Friday 8:30am-12:30pm (20 hours per week)
